| Re: Stainless Front Bumper Alan. There was a discussion on this a while back. I believe both GD and Dax fit them as standard. The concensus was that provided any light emits the required amount of light, Sva will pass them regardless of E marking. I may be wrong, but my tester certainly didnt look for E markings.

| Re: Stainless Front Bumper Cobra289 These are Dax's front overriders and nudge bar. Not cheap, but good quality and stainless. Steve - I like your front no. plate - strategically placed for speed (s)cameras?! Alan, Chris is right that the Dax light kit includes these as standard, and they aren't E marked. This didn't seem to bother my SVA tester, who only seemed interested in them working. He was interested, however, in the E markings of the headlights and the fog light, but this might just have been to save him checking brightness and colour and what not. Andy

| Re: Stainless Front Bumper After 19 years of using the nice chrome bumpers and over-riders from DAX they got some rusty and it is time to improve the looks. I prefer stainless because there are easy to polish after some years of driving. Andy I have checked the price list of DAX and they don't have stainless nudge bars they sell chrome one at the front for 80 pounds. You can check that are stainless with a magnet, if the magnet stick, they are plain carbon steel. See my picture of the actual bumper. Steve G Do you have an e-mail address of Brasscraft?
